Develop high-impact skills with an online master’s in healthcare management

Prepare to lead with a blend of strategic, operational, and people-focused capabilities:

Strategic leadership and organisational change

Learn to develop long-term plans, lead change initiatives, and foster innovation across healthcare organisations.

Health economics and finance

Understand budgeting, cost-effectiveness, and financial management in healthcare contexts.

Quality improvement and patient safety

Explore tools and frameworks to evaluate services, improve care delivery, and enhance patient outcomes.

Health policy and systems

Gain insight into how national and global health systems are structured — and how policy influences decision-making and resource allocation.

People management and communication

Build the leadership, communication, and team management skills required to lead diverse, multidisciplinary teams.

Graduates work as healthcare leaders across hospitals, primary care, government agencies, NGOs, and consulting firms. Typical roles include hospital operations manager, service transformation lead, health policy advisor, or director of healthcare programmes.

Programmes typically take 1 to 3 years depending on whether you study part-time or full-time. Flexible options allow you to complete your degree around your professional responsibilities.
